Core Insights - Huawei officially launched the nova 15 series smartphones on December 24, 2025, which includes three models powered by Kirin 8020 and Kirin 9010S processors, with a starting price of 2699 yuan [1][4]. Product Features - The nova 15 Ultra and Pro versions support NearLink E2.0 technology, enabling audio features and connectivity with compatible devices like FreeBuds Pro 5, while the standard version supports NearLink E1.0 primarily for peripheral connections [1][4]. - NearLink technology is a new wireless short-range communication standard developed by the International NearLink Wireless Short-Distance Communication Alliance, offering low power consumption, low latency, high speed, and high reliability [5][6]. Audio Technology - The core technology for headphone connectivity is a significant application of NearLink, enhancing the connection performance between headphones and host devices, utilizing Polar codes to improve anti-interference capabilities and audio transmission quality [3][5]. - Huawei introduced a precise locating feature for headphones, allowing users to find lost headphones using another Huawei device by logging into the same account and activating the "Find" service [3][5]. Supported Devices - Currently, devices supporting NearLink audio functionality include the Mate 80 series, Mate X7 series, nova 15 Pro, and nova 15 Ultra, with plans for future OTA upgrades to include Pura 80 series and Mate XTs models [4][6].

Core Viewpoint - Huawei's nova 15 series, including nova 15, nova 15 Pro, and nova 15 Ultra, aims to enhance user experience through improved system performance, battery life, and camera capabilities, targeting young consumers with a focus on photography and connectivity [2][13][27] System and Performance - The nova 15 series is equipped with HarmonyOS 6.0 and Wi-Fi 7, featuring the Kirin 8020 processor in the standard version and the Kirin 9010S processor in Pro and Ultra versions, which is an overclocked variant of the 8020 [2][16] - The performance of the Kirin 9010S is similar to the 9010 but with lower power consumption, although its GPU performance is slightly inferior [2][16] Battery and Endurance - The standard version has a 6000mAh battery with 100W wired charging, while both Pro and Ultra versions feature a 6500mAh battery with the same wired charging capability, and the Ultra version also supports 50W wireless charging [4][18] - The Ultra version's design allows for a 6500mAh battery within a thickness of 6.8mm, indicating strong endurance capabilities [4][18] Design and Differentiation - The nova 15 series features a clear differentiation in storage options, with the standard and Pro versions offering 256GB and 512GB, while the Ultra version provides an additional 1TB option [4][18] - The design includes a "horizontal large matrix" camera module for Pro and Ultra versions, enhancing the aesthetic appeal and aligning with the new design language of the nova series [6][20] Color and Aesthetics - The nova 15 series is available in four colors: "Vibrant Green," "Good Match Purple," "Zero Degree White," and "Phantom Night Black," aimed at enhancing brand recognition and appealing to younger consumers [9][23] Imaging Capabilities - The standard version features a 50MP main camera, while the Pro and Ultra versions have enhanced camera setups, including multiple 50MP sensors and advanced features for improved photography [10][24] - The introduction of "dual red maple" technology in the Pro and Ultra versions aims to enhance selfie quality, particularly in challenging lighting conditions [10][24] Display Quality - The standard version has a 6.7-inch OLED display with a resolution of 2412*1084 and a 120Hz refresh rate, while the Pro and Ultra versions feature a 6.84-inch OLED display with a resolution of 2856*1320 and dynamic refresh rates [11][25] - The display quality is supported by TCL Huaxing, ensuring a consistent and high-quality viewing experience [11][25] Overall Market Positioning - The nova 15 series reflects a shift in the industry towards integrated user experiences rather than just individual specifications, focusing on reliability and user-friendly features [13][27] - The series aims to establish a strong market presence by appealing to the needs of young consumers who prioritize photography and connectivity [13][27]
